Color-neutral and reversible tissue transparency enables longitudinal deep-tissue imaging in live mice.

Summary

Researchers developed a novel method for achieving optical transparency in live mice across the visible spectrum. This technique enables deep in vivo imaging and long-term tracking of cellular activity without causing harm.
